The steam is coming out but no pressure when I press the button for the steam to jet out
If you're experiencing an issue where steam is coming out but there's no pressure when you press the button for the steam to jet out, there could be a few possible causes:
- Water level: Check the water level in the steam generator or steam-producing device. If the water level is too low, it can result in insufficient steam pressure. Make sure there is enough water in the device according to the manufacturer's instructions.
- Clogged steam vents: Over time, mineral deposits or debris can accumulate in the steam vents, obstructing the flow of steam. This can prevent the steam from building up pressure. Clean the steam vents thoroughly by following the manufacturer's instructions to ensure proper steam flow.
- Faulty heating element: The heating element is responsible for generating steam. If it is malfunctioning or damaged, it may not produce enough heat to generate adequate pressure. In this case, you may need to have the heating element inspected or replaced by a professional.
- Malfunctioning steam generator: If you're using a steam generator, it's possible that there is an issue with the device itself. Check for any error codes or warning indicators and consult the manufacturer's troubleshooting guide. If the problem persists, contact the manufacturer or a qualified technician for assistance.

What direction do I turn the button to open the Rowenta Superpress 050? I have read that I need to push in the button but it was donated to me and I need to fill up the reservoir.
To open the Rowenta Superpress 050 iron, you should first unplug the iron from the power source for safety. Then, locate the water reservoir button on the top of the iron. The button is usually located near the back of the iron.
To open the reservoir, you need to push the button inward and turn it counter-clockwise. This will release the reservoir from the iron's body, allowing you to fill it with water.
After filling the reservoir with water, you can reattach it to the iron by aligning it with the body and turning the button clockwise until it clicks into place.
Remember to never fill the reservoir above the maximum fill line, as this can cause the iron to leak water or even cause damage to the iron.

Circuit diagram for ESP2 singer steam press
I do not have access to specific circuit diagrams for the ESP2 Singer Steam Press. However, I can provide some general information that may be helpful.
The ESP2 Singer Steam Press operates by using an electric heating element to heat a water reservoir, which produces steam to press clothes and fabrics. The electrical circuitry of the steam press includes a power switch, heating element, thermostat, thermal fuse, and indicator lights.
The power switch controls the flow of electricity to the steam press, allowing the user to turn it on and off. The heating element heats up the water in the reservoir, producing steam that is released through a pressing plate. The thermostat controls the temperature of the heating element, ensuring that the water is heated to the desired temperature. The thermal fuse acts as a safety device, preventing the steam press from overheating and potentially causing a fire. Finally, the indicator lights inform the user of the steam press's current operating status, such as whether it is heating up or ready to use.
If you're experiencing issues with your ESP2 Singer Steam Press, it's recommended that you consult the user manual or contact a qualified technician for assistance. Modifying or repairing electrical equipment without proper knowledge or training can be dangerous and may cause injury or damage to the equipment.

The temperature control dial of my Bosch Sensixx x DA30 iron has become very stiff to rotate. How to make it easier to turn?
If the temperature control dial of your Bosch Sensixx x DA30 iron has become stiff, you can try the following steps to make it easier to turn:
- Unplug the iron and let it cool down completely.
- Using a soft cloth or sponge, clean the dial and the surrounding area to remove any dust or debris.
- Apply a small amount of WD-40 or silicone spray lubricant to the temperature control dial.
- Slowly turn the dial back and forth a few times to distribute the lubricant and loosen up any dirt or debris that may have been causing the stiffness.
- Wipe away any excess lubricant with a clean, dry cloth.
- Plug in the iron and turn it on to make sure the temperature control dial is turning smoothly.
If the stiffness persists or the temperature control dial is still not turning smoothly, you may need to take your iron to a professional for repair or replacement of the dial.
